What is the capitol of Iowa?

The capital of Iowa is Des Moines. 
Quick Facts:
  • Location: Situated in Polk County in central Iowa, along the Des Moines River.
  • History: It officially became the state capital in 1857, replacing the former capital, Iowa City.
  • Key Landmarks: It is home to the iconic gold-domed Iowa State Capitol.
  • Economy & Politics: The city is a major hub for the insurance and financial services industries and famously hosts the nation's first presidential caucuses.

What two-time US presidential hopeful was born in the Panama Canal Zone?

John McCain was the prominent two-time presidential hopeful born in the Panama Canal Zone.

The late Arizona Senator and decorated war hero was born at the Coco Solo Naval Air Station on August 29, 1936, while his father was stationed there with the U.S. Navy. He went on to seek the U.S. presidency twice, launching unsuccessful campaigns for the Republican nomination in 2000 and the general election in 2008. 
Because he was born outside of the 50 United States, his birthplace triggered minor public debate during his 2008 campaign regarding the constitutional requirement for a president to be a "natural-born citizen". However, legal scholars and a nonbinding resolution passed by the U.S. Senate confirmed his eligibility, as his parents were U.S. citizens and the area was under U.S. jurisdiction at the time of his birth.
